Sushmita Sen's Ex-Boyfriend Rohman Shawl Accused Of ‘Living Under Miss Universe's Shadow', His Reaction Wins Internet

New Delhi: Model and actor Rohman Shawl, Sushmita Sen's ex-boyfriend, recently celebrated seven years with her through a heartfelt post. The post caught netizens' attention, with many questioning their current relationship status.
In a long post, Rohman expressed gratitude to the former Miss Universe, along with a black-and-white photo of the two.
The actor-model wrote while celebrating their seven years, 'Some stories outgrow their titles, but never their meaning.' He added that the duo are 'Not lovers, not strangers, something softer, rarer!!! You were once my safe place & somehow, still are!!!!'

One user accused Rohman of 'living in Sushmita's shadow.' The comment read: 'Friend-zoned you are! Just get out of it and own yourself! Individually, you can do more than living just as a shadow of Ms Universe!'
Rohman's graceful reply to the comment won hearts online, as he emphasized that being associated with someone remarkable doesn't diminish him.
He wrote: 'Being associated with someone remarkable doesn't diminish me; it reflects the kind of people I choose to walk beside. And my love, galaxies don't cast shadows—they shine together!! Much love.'
His response earned praise from many, who appreciated his composure and maturity.
Sushmita Sen and Rohman Shawl's Relationship
Rohman and Sushmita were first linked in 2018. In 2021, Sushmita confirmed their breakup with an Instagram post. She shared a picture with Rohman and wrote: 'We began as friends, we remain friends!! The relationship was long over… the love remains!!'
However, the two have continued to be spotted at public events and gatherings, often raising eyebrows about their bond.
On the work front, Rohman made his acting debut last year with the Tamil film Amaran, where he played the antagonist and received critical acclaim for his performance. Meanwhile, Sushmita Sen was last seen in the show Taali: Bajaungi Nahi, Bajwaungi.

Neeraj Pandey calls out AI-altered ‘Raanjhanaa' ending as ‘disrespectful', slams Eros for excluding creators

Filmmaker Neeraj Pandey has joined the growing chorus of voices condemning Eros International Media's decision to re-release Raanjhanaa's Tamil-dubbed version Ambikapathy with an alternate AI-generated ending. The revised climax — designed to be 'happier' — is set to hit theatres on August 1, but has already triggered significant backlash within the film industry. 'This is utterly disrespectful,' Pandey told NDTV, stressing that using AI to alter a film without involving its original creators violates artistic integrity. 'AI is just a tool. A human being is operating it. It's the intent behind it that matters. If a piece of cinema is being altered without the director or writer, they could have done better.' Pandey, known for Special 26 and Baby, said he was 'zapped' by the move, criticising Eros for failing to communicate with the filmmakers. 'Saying 'we have the rights' is no excuse,' he added. 'A little communication wouldn't have hurt.' The AI-modified version of Ambikapathy has drawn criticism from Raanjhanaa director Aanand L Rai, who called the development 'heartbreaking.' Other figures including Kabir Khan, Kanika Dhillon, and Renuka Shahane have called the decision unethical and damaging to cinematic storytelling. In its defence, Eros issued a statement calling itself the 'sole producer and exclusive copyright holder' of Raanjhanaa. The studio said the new ending is 'legally compliant, transparently labelled, and artistically guided,' created with AI as a support tool — not a replacement for human creativity. Eros also pushed back against Rai and actor Dhanush over comments and promotional links between Raanjhanaa and Rai's upcoming film Tere Ishk Mein, claiming they had no legal right to use the original film's brand. A cease and desist notice was reportedly issued on July 25.

Nimrat Kaur finally breaks her silence over dating rumours with Abhishek Bachchan, says 'Mujhe unke liye...'

Bollywood actress Nimrat Kaur is known for her strong acting. She has proved her talent in many films. Recently, Nimrat Kaur spoke openly about the rumors about her personal life. The actress says that she feels sorry for those who spread rumors and circulate them on social media. Her reaction came after dating rumors with Abhishek Bachchan last year. When Nimrat Kaur breaks the silence on speculations? While Nimrat Kuar was present at the News18 SheShakti event, she spoke about the rumours about her personal life and said, 'Social media is an amoeba in itself, it grows anytime, anywhere, for any reason, whether there is a reason or not. I am very clear about what my focus should be in life. I did not come to Mumbai for social media; it did not exist at that time. There were no smartphones either.' Saiyaara Star Aneet Padda Gets Emotional Watching Surprise Tribute From Her School

After the success of Saiyaara, Aneet Padda received a heartfelt surprise tribute from her alma mater, Springdale Senior School. Aneet Padda is currently basking in the soaring success of her recently released film 'Saiyaara', alongside Ahaan Panday. The actress was left surprised and emotional after she received a heartfelt tribute from her alma mater, Springdale Senior School, Amritsar. The video featured her former teachers, principal, mentors and current students lauding Aneet's journey, and recalling fond memories with her. They congratulated her and expressed how proud they feel. In response, Aneet penned an emotional note, stating that she had the biggest smile on her face and tears in her eyes, as she watched the lovely video. She expressed her hope that she's making her school proud—not just with her work, but with the person she's becoming. Aneet Padda shared the lovely video which shows her teachers and mentors praising her journey from the classrooms of Spring Dale Senior School to the big screens. The video features nostalgic throwback photos of Aneet from school events, including annual functions and other memorable moments.
